CVE-2006-6291

CVE-2006-6291 describes a stack overflow in MailEnable’s IMAP module (MEIMAPS.EXE) affecting MailEnable Professional 1.6–1.83 and 2.0–2.33, and MailEnable Enterprise 1.1–1.40 and 2.0–2.33. An authenticated remote user could crash the service by sending a long argument containing * and ? character...
